3 reasons to get it:

1. It is made with higher quality materials.
2. The darker color will not show as much dirt
3. Depending on the other color choice of you car, it migh tlook better. I have a HB/B MCS With Blue and black leather. The light gray would look out of place.

Hi,
I'm new here. First post. Ordered a CR MCS w/black top and red and black interior on 29MAY06. I previously drove a (red) 1990 BMW 325iS for several years. (Sad story for my car and for the deer on 19MAY06.) LOVED that car. The interior was very German: simple, functional, no-nonsense. Although my unquestionable choice (love at first drive!) as a successor, the MCS is a different creature in terms of interior materials and very un-German nostalgic qurkiness. My wife and I did not care for the swirly grey plastic dash--or the hard plastic used inside in general. The grey headliner did not help out. It seems too light both in color and in thickness and it has no texture. Once we saw the anthracite headliner side by side with the grey headliner, there was no question about ordering the anthracite. The anthracite headliner, along with the red interior dash and doors (which we also saw in real life) do a lot to make the interior seem more solid, to give it visual weight,etc. Took nothing away from the sportiness and did not ladle undesired "class" on the car; only added to the feeling of being inside a solid and very special automobile. (Also, as already noted in the thread, the anthracite headliner will be much easier to keep clean.) Recommend that you do a on-site comparison yourself--for every element of the car that you can make possiblydecisions on, because the proof is in the pudding . . . !
